aboutsummaryrefslogtreecommitdiff
Commit message (Collapse)AuthorAgeFilesLines
* derive Default for nameserver callsHEADmasterHimbeerserverDE2023-10-101-2/+2
|
* add an optional way to override DNS resolutionHimbeerserverDE2023-09-181-9/+36
|
* impl From<Endpoint> for &strHimbeerserverDE2023-09-181-0/+9
|
* update production endpoint ip addressHimbeerserverDE2023-09-141-1/+1
| | | | A new mechanism should be implemented that allows importers to hijack DNS resolution themselves if they need it. The library should not do this unless asked to.
* dns resolution: support rustkrazyHimbeerserverDE2023-08-171-1/+12
|
* update dependencies to prevent future incompatibilitiesHimbeerserverDE2023-08-171-1/+1
|
* add tests?HimbeerserverDE2023-08-171-0/+42
|
* bad status error: add missing )HimbeerserverDE2023-01-171-1/+1
|
* remove leading /HimbeerserverDE2022-11-201-1/+1
|
* remove debug loggingHimbeerserverDE2022-11-051-3/+0
|
* simplify response verificationHimbeerserverDE2022-11-057-26/+62
|
* cargo fmtHimbeerserverDE2022-11-051-1/+1
|
* implement response traits for nameserver callsHimbeerserverDE2022-11-051-1/+16
|
* cargo fmtHimbeerserverDE2022-11-051-2/+5
|
* switch to custom serde_xmlrpc forkHimbeerserverDE2022-11-0510-536/+112
| | | | closes #3
* rename err -> eHimbeerserverDE2022-11-021-11/+11
| | | | closes #6
* final `String`ificationHimbeerserverDE2022-11-012-7/+7
|
* move error module to single fileHimbeerserverDE2022-11-011-0/+0
|
* don't expose raw response data to publicHimbeerserverDE2022-10-301-1/+1
|
* ditch opensslHimbeerserverDE2022-10-301-2/+10
| | | | temporarily fixes #5 until #3 is implemented
* Revert "use rustls"HimbeerserverDE2022-10-281-1/+1
| | | | This reverts commit ec490bd28901781c42f7a511d465164938fe060e.
* use rustlsHimbeerserverDE2022-10-281-1/+1
|
* `String`ify EndpointHimbeerserverDE2022-10-241-5/+5
|
* apply clippy lints: ok_or_elseHimbeerserverDE2022-10-242-7/+9
|
* get rid of some of the static lifetimesHimbeerserverDE2022-10-248-79/+87
|
* move shared call and response data types to their own separate moduleHimbeerserverDE2022-10-225-255/+263
|
* add nameserver.updateRecordHimbeerserverDE2022-10-222-0/+95
| | | | no response to this call exists so we don't need to implement it
* make record response parameters optional according to api docsHimbeerserverDE2022-10-221-31/+45
|
* Revert "reduce nameserver.info response to correct members"HimbeerserverDE2022-10-222-0/+40
| | | | This reverts commit a8ea04b12acfb4a91ec44201fff1ffc282de539e.
* don't ignore individual record parsing errorsHimbeerserverDE2022-10-221-2/+2
|
* reduce nameserver.info response to correct membersHimbeerserverDE2022-10-222-40/+0
|
* derive/require clone and debug for all calls and responsesHimbeerserverDE2022-10-223-1/+4
|
* implement response parsingHimbeerserverDE2022-10-221-21/+71
|
* derive clone and debug traits for record infoHimbeerserverDE2022-10-221-0/+1
|
* make nameserver.info parameters optionalHimbeerserverDE2022-10-221-16/+36
|
* cargo fmtHimbeerserverDE2022-10-223-33/+18
|
* use std::string::String instead of &str in callsHimbeerserverDE2022-10-221-9/+9
|
* add nameserver.info responseHimbeerserverDE2022-10-225-3/+236
|
* RecordType: fix clippy warningsHimbeerserverDE2022-10-221-47/+47
|
* add nameserver.infoHimbeerserverDE2022-10-222-0/+111
|
* add \nHimbeerserverDE2022-10-221-0/+1
|
* basic readmeHimbeerserverDE2022-10-211-0/+2
|
* add licenseHimbeerserverDE2022-10-211-0/+21
|
* accept empty responsesHimbeerserverDE2022-10-211-1/+3
|
* re-export clientHimbeerserverDE2022-10-211-1/+1
|
* making callsHimbeerserverDE2022-10-214-29/+63
|
* initial call/response structureHimbeerserverDE2022-10-215-10/+78
|
* add client destructorHimbeerserverDE2022-10-211-0/+6
|
* add client constructorHimbeerserverDE2022-10-211-1/+18
|
* add reqwest error variantHimbeerserverDE2022-10-211-0/+8
|